Former NBA star Allan Houston is selling his immense home in Westchester and it won’t come cheap.
Houston’s house, all 19,300 square feet of it (with 10 acres of property), is going on the market for $19.9 million. The home comes equipped with seven bedrooms, 10 full bathrooms and two half baths.
Of course, the “hand cut stone” abode also comes with a few extra perks. There’s a circular trophy room, a gym, an indoor basketball court, a swimming pool and “a golf practice area with a putting green and sand trap.”
Heck, the property includes land that edges up against Converse Lake as well if one demands even more recreational activities from their home.
The home has frontage on Converse Lake, which can be used for swimming and canoeing.
If $20 million sounds like a lot, it’s actually $5 million less than what it was previously listed for on the market so if you have $20 million to throw around, this amazing “bargain” could be yours.
